Linux 系统:深入浅出的全面剖析100

Linux 是一种自由开源的操作系统,自 1991 年诞生以来,已经成为世界上最流行的操作系统之一。它以其稳定性、可靠性和可定制性而闻名,使其成为服务器、工作站和嵌入式系统的不二之选。

Linux 的历史与演变

Linux 是由芬兰大学生 Linus Torvalds 创建的,最初仅是一个简单的个人项目。随着时间的推移,Linux 吸引了众多开发者的关注和贡献,它不断发展并成熟,成为一个功能齐全、功能强大的操作系统。

Linux 发行版

Linux 发行版是由不同的组织或个人创建和维护的 Linux 操作系统的版本。每个发行版都有自己的独特功能和特性,迎合不同的用户群。一些流行的 Linux 发行版包括 Ubuntu、Red Hat Enterprise Linux、CentOS 和 Debian。

Linux 内核

Linux 内核是 Linux 操作系统的心脏。它的职责包括管理硬件资源、处理进程和提供系统调用。Linux 内核不断发展和改进,提供新的特性和功能。

文件系统

Linux 使用一种称为文件系统的树形结构来组织和管理文件和目录。Linux 支持多种文件系统,包括 Ext4、XFS 和 Btrfs。每种文件系统都有其自身的优势和劣势,适合不同的用例。

用户界面

Linux 可以使用各种图形用户界面 (GUI),例如 GNOME、KDE 和 Xfce。这些 GUI 提供了一个用户友好的界面,允许用户轻松地与系统交互。Linux 还可以使用命令行界面 (CLI),为高级用户提供更直接的控制。

包管理

Linux 使用包管理系统来安装、更新和删除软件。包管理系统使维护软件安装变得简单,并确保系统安全可靠。Linux 有多种包管理系统可用,例如 APT、Yum 和 DNF。

安全性

Linux 以其安全性而闻名。它提供了许多安全功能,例如用户权限、访问控制和防火墙。Linux 系统通常不容易受到病毒和恶意软件的攻击,使其成为服务器和关键任务系统的理想选择。

网络

Linux 具有强大的网络功能,使其能够与其他计算机和设备无缝通信。它支持各种网络协议和服务,例如 TCP/IP、HTTP 和 SSH。Linux 还可以用作路由器、防火墙和虚拟专用网络 (VPN)。

虚拟化

Linux 是创建和管理虚拟机的理想平台。它可以运行各种虚拟化软件,例如 KVM、Xen 和 VMware。虚拟化使您可以在一台物理服务器上运行多个操作系统,从而提高资源利用率和灵活性。

云计算

Linux 是云计算环境中的重要角色。它作为许多云服务、平台和基础设施的基础。Linux 的稳定性、可扩展性和开源性质使其成为云计算的绝佳选择。

Linux 是一个功能强大且用途广泛的操作系统,提供了一系列面向服务器、工作站、嵌入式系统和云计算的特性和功能。它以其稳定性、可靠性和可定制性而闻名,使其成为 IT 专业人员和爱好者的首选。随着 Linux 社区的持续发展,我们可以在未来期待更多创新和进步。

2024-10-11


上一篇:Linux 系统性能优化指南

下一篇:Windows 7 系统重装指南:从备份到完成